Как убрать в Excel R: устранение ошибок и лишних символов

Внезапное появление буквы «R» перед номерами строк и столбцов в заголовках таблицы или в формулах означает, что программа переключилась в специальный режим адресации, известный как R1C1. Вместо привычных обозначений A1, B2 вы видите R1C1, что сбивает с толку большинство пользователей, привыкших к стандартной нотации. Чтобы вернуть обычный вид, достаточно изменить одну настройку в параметрах программы, но важно сначала убедиться, что проблема именно в режиме отображения, а не в ошибке вычислений или лишнем символе в тексте ячейки.

Существует три основных сценария, когда требуется убрать R в Excel: переключение режима ссылок, очистка текстовых данных от лишних символов или исправление ошибки #ССЫЛКА!, которая визуально может восприниматься как проблема с буквой R. Каждый случай требует своего подхода: от простого снятия галочки в меню до использования функций замены текста или перепроверки удаленных диапазонов. Понимание причины появления этого символа позволяет мгновенно диагностировать проблему и восстановить нормальную работу с документом.

Переключение режима ссылок R1C1 на стандартный A1

Наиболее частая причина появления буквы R в заголовках столбцов — активация режима ссылок R1C1. В этом режиме строки (Row) и столбцы (Column) нумеруются цифрами, что удобно для программистов, но неудобно для обычных пользователей. Чтобы убрать R в Excel и вернуть классический вид (A, B, C..), необходимо зайти в настройки приложения. Нажмите на вкладку «Файл», выберите «Параметры», затем перейдите в раздел «Формулы».

В блоке «Работа с формулами» найдите галочку «Стиль ссылок R1C1». Если она установлена, снимите её и нажмите «ОК». Интерфейс мгновенно изменится: буквенные обозначения столбцов вернутся на место, а в формулах адреса ячеек снова станут привычными, например $A$1 вместо R1C1. Это глобальная настройка, которая применится ко всем новым и открытым книгам.

⚠️ Внимание: После переключения режима ссылки в уже существующих формулах могут измениться визуально, но их вычисления останутся корректными. Однако, если вы копировали формулы с абсолютными адресами в стиле R1C1, перепроверьте логику вычислений.

Иногда пользователи случайно активируют этот режим, нажав сочетание клавиш или импортировав настройки из другого источника. Важно понимать разницу между относительными и абсолютными ссылками в этом контексте. В режиме R1C1 относительная ссылка на ячейку справа отображается как R[0]C[1], что может быть совершенно непонятно без подготовки. Возврат к стилю A1 делает навигацию интуитивной.

📊 Какой стиль ссылок вам привычнее?
A1 (стандартный)
R1C1 (программистский)
Не знаю, какой у меня сейчас
Мешают оба варианта

Удаление буквы R из текстовых данных в ячейках

Если буква R встречается внутри текста ячеек (например, «Товар R-123») и ее нужно убрать в Excel, используйте функцию замены. Выделите диапазон данных, нажмите Ctrl+H или выберите на вкладке «Главная» кнопку «Найти и выделить» -> «Заменить». В поле «Найти» введите букву R, а поле «Заменить на» оставьте пустым.

Для более сложной очистки, когда нужно удалить R только в определенных случаях (например, только если за ней следует цифра), потребуется использование формулы или макроса. Функция ПОДСТАВИТЬ позволяет заменить конкретный символ на пустоту. Например, формула =ПОДСТАВИТЬ(A1;"R";"") удалит все вхождения буквы R из текста в ячейке A1.

  • 🔍 Используйте «Найти и заменить» для быстрой очистки больших массивов данных от лишних символов.
  • 🧹 Функция СЖПРОБЕЛЫ поможет убрать лишние пробелы, которые могли остаться после удаления символов.
  • ⚡ Для сложных условий удаления используйте текстовые функции ЛЕВСИМВ, ПРАВСИМВ в комбинации с ЕСЛИ.

При работе с импортированными данными из других систем (1С, ERP-системы) часто встречаются артефакты в виде префиксов. Автоматизация процесса очистки через Power Query будет наиболее эффективным решением для регулярных отчетов. Вы можете настроить шаг замены символов один раз и применять его при каждой новой загрузке данных.

☑️ Проверка перед удалением символов

Выполнено: 0 / 4

Устранение ошибки #ССЫЛКА! (связанной с R)

Одной из самых неприятных проблем является появление ошибки #ССЫЛКА! (в английской версии #REF!). Пользователи часто ищут, как убрать в экселе r, имея в виду именно эту ошибку, так как слово «ссылка» ассоциируется с буквой R. Эта ошибка возникает, когда формула ссылается на ячейку, которая была удалена или перемещена.

Чтобы исправить ситуацию, необходимо найти ячейку с ошибкой и проанализировать формулу. Обычно Excel подсвечивает часть формулы, которая стала недействительной. Если вы удалили столбец или строку, на которые ссылалась формула, ссылку нужно обновить вручную или отменить последнее действие (Ctrl+Z), если файл еще не сохранен.

Тип ошибки Причина возникновения Способ устранения
#ССЫЛКА! Удаление ячейки, на которую была ссылка Восстановить ячейку или изменить формулу
#ЗНАЧ! Неверный тип данных в аргументе Проверить данные в referenced ячейках
#ДЕЛ/0! Деление на ноль Использовать функцию ЕСЛИОШИБКА
#ИМЯ? Ошибка в имени функции или диапазоне Проверить правописание формулы

Часто ошибка #ССЫЛКА! распространяется при копировании формулы. Если в одной ячейке формула «сломалась» из-за удаления диапазона, то при протягивании этой формулы вниз ошибка появится во всех соседних ячейках. В таких случаях проще заново прописать формулу для первой ячейки и скопировать её, чем исправлять каждую вручную.

Как найти все ошибки сразу?

Используйте функцию «Выделение группы ячеек». Нажмите F5 -> Выделить -> Выберите «Формулы» и оставьте галочку только на «Ошибки». Excel выделит все проблемные ячейки на листе.

Использование функций для очистки текста от R

Для продвинутой работы с текстом, когда нужно убрать R в Excel выборочно, применяются текстовые функции. Например, если нужно удалить только первую букву R, используйте комбинацию функций НАЙТИ и ЗАМЕНИТЬ. Формула =ЗАМЕНИТЬ(A1; НАЙТИ("R"; A1); 1;"") найдет позицию первой R и заменит её на пустоту.

Если задача стоит удалить все числовые значения, оставив только буквы, или наоборот, можно использовать сложные конструкции с массивами (в новых версиях Excel) или пользовательские функции VBA. Однако для большинства задач достаточно стандартного набора инструментов.

  • 📝 Функция ПСТР позволяет извлечь часть текста, игнорируя unwanted символы.
  • 🔄 СЦЕПИТЬ или оператор & помогут собрать очищенный текст заново.
  • 🎯 ПЕЧСИМВ удалит все непечатаемые символы, которые часто идут в паре с мусорным текстом.

При массовом редактировании столбца с данными создайте вспомогательный столбец с формулой очистки. После применения формулы скопируйте результат и вставьте его на исходное место как «Значения». Это статичный метод, который разорвет связь с исходными данными и ускорит работу файла.

Работа с макросами для автоматизации удаления

Если вам приходится постоянно убирать R в Excel в отчетах, имеет смысл автоматизировать процесс через макрос VBA. Скрипт может проходить по выделенному диапазону и удалятьнные символы или исправлять настройки отображения. Это особенно актуально для корпоративной среды, где отчеты формируются регулярно.

Пример простого макроса для удаления буквы R из выделенных ячеек:

Sub RemoveR

Dim cell As Range

For Each cell In Selection

If Not cell.HasFormula Then

cell.Value = Replace(cell.Value,"R","")

End If

Next cell

End Sub

Запуск макроса осуществляется через вкладку «Разработчик» или сочетанием клавиш. Использование VBA требует осторожности, так как ошибки в коде могут повредить данные. Рекомендуется тестировать макросы на копии файла. Также макросы могут быть заблокированы настройками безопасности Excel, поэтому может потребоваться разрешение на запуск.

⚠️ Внимание: Файлы с макросами необходимо сохранять в формате .xlsm. Если сохранить такой файл как обычный .xlsx, код будет утерян при закрытии.

Профилактика появления ошибок и лишних символов

Чтобы в будущем не сталкиваться с вопросом, как убрать в экселе r, следует придерживаться правил гигиены данных. При импорте информации из внешних источников всегда проверяйте формат ячеек и наличие скрытых символов. Использование Таблиц Excel (Ctrl+T) помогает структурировать данные и минимизировать ошибки ссылок.

Регулярное обновление программного обеспечения также решает многие проблемы, так как Microsoft постоянно улучшает алгоритмы обработки формул и импорта. Кроме того, изучение базовых принципов построения формул поможет избегать ситуаций, ведущих к ошибкам #ССЫЛКА!.

Понимание природы возникновения символа R позволяет быстро выбрать правильный инструмент решения. Будь то настройка интерфейса или чистка данных, Excel предоставляет все необходимые средства для эффективной работы.

Часто задаваемые вопросы (FAQ)

Почему в формулах вместо A1 написано R1C1?

Это означает, что включен альтернативный стиль ссылок. Чтобы вернуть обычный вид, зайдите в Файл -> Параметры -> Формулы и снимите галочку «Стиль ссылок R1C1».

Как удалить букву R только в начале слова?

Используйте функцию ЕСЛИ вместе с ЛЕВСИМВ. Например: =ЕСЛИ(ЛЕВСИМВ(A1;1)="R"; ПСТР(A1;2;ДЛСТР(A1)); A1). Эта формула проверит первый символ и обрежет его, если это R.

Что делать, если Excel пишет #ССЫЛКА! после удаления строки?

Формула ссылается на удаленную ячейку. Нажмите Ctrl+Z, чтобы вернуть строку, или отредактируйте формулу, указав адрес существующей ячейки.

Можно ли навсегда отключить стиль R1C1 для всех файлов?

Да, это настройка самого приложения Excel. once вы снимете галочку в параметрах, этот стиль перестанет использоваться во всех книгах на этом компьютере до тех пор, пока вы снова её не включите.

Как быстро найти все ячейки с ошибкой #ССЫЛКА!?

Нажмите F5, выберите кнопку «Выделить», затем выберите «Формулы» и оставьте галочку только на пункте «Ошибки». Excel выделит все проблемные ячейки.